Transaction 31deb21ee9aa142bb22e36ce86d0ee6ed78811445a212e24acd3812553063bf0
1 Input
1 Output
-
31deb21ee9aa142bb22e36ce86d0ee6ed78811445a212e24acd3812553063bf0:0
- value
- 2672790
- script pubkey
- OP_0 OP_PUSHBYTES_20 d2128e1da16106f0569632315eeb79d66d40a2f7
- address
- bc1q6gfgu8dpvyr0q45kxgc4a6me6ek5pghhkkpp6n